Science lessons from WGBH/NASA collaboration premiere online

WGBH has launched a set of interactive educational resources funded by a $10 million grant from NASA.

The digital lessons, aimed at students from kindergarten through high school, focus on Earth-science subjects such as weather, climate, land and water, according to the announcement Thursday. Content includes satellite images and data visualizations from NASA as well as videos from the science series Nova and the kids’ show Peep & the Big Wide World.

Teachers have access to related materials such as background essays, teaching tips and handouts through PBS LearningMedia online. The content is aligned to Next Generation Science Standards.

WGBH developed the content with input from 50 teacher advisers.

The content is the first in the series “Bringing the Universe to America’s Classrooms.” The five-year NASA grant was announced in May 2016.
